Fingal's Pinnacles, Flodigarry
Summary
Escape the crowds at the Quiraing on this fine circuit exploring fascinating lochs, cliffs and pinnacles.
Terrain
An excellent path for the outward walk uphill; the return walk crosses some pathless moorland and steep grass slopes
Public Transport
Bus number 57 from Portree. Ask to get off at foot of Loch Langaig footpath - 0.5km north from the roadside picnic area by the loch at Dunans.
Start
Start of Loch Langaig/Harsco footpath, Flodigarry.
